According to Grips Intelligence in-store data, Sky Rider commanded an average product price of $61.56 across the January 1–June 30, 2026 period tracked on Home Depot's channel, though this figure softened to $48.30 in the most recent month, an overall decline of 27.5%. The brand's distribution remained heavily concentrated, with homedepot.com accounting for 99.1% of year-to-date revenue share. On the revenue side, Grips Intelligence data shows performance weakened sharply, with revenue down 26.2% versus the prior month. Cumulatively, revenue fell 79.5% over the tracked window, signaling significant contraction in Sky Rider's in-store presence. These combined pricing and revenue trends point to a period of meaningful decline for the brand within its primary retail channel.
